

Louvina Sims Lester, 73, passed from this life following a long illness on Dec. 5, 2017. “Lou” as she was known to all, was a businesswoman and a homemaker. She was Co-owner of Lester’s Tractor and Equipment for 30 years until her death. She was a gentle and caring soul with a warm smile for all she met. She loved her family dearly; she will be sorely missed by all those who knew her.
Lou was a member of Kingston Road UPC, a past matron, and a past district deputy grand matron of the Order of the Eastern Star, Greenwood chapter #202.
Preceding her in death was her father, Willis Benjamin Sims., her mother Sarah Jordan Sims, and 9 siblings. Left to mourn her passing is her brother Wilbert Sims of Hobbs, NM, her husband of 56 years, 3 months and 23 days, Albert Lynn Lester, daughter Cynthia Ann Ferguson and husband Michael of Stonewall, LA , son Steven Lynn Lester and wife Patti of Rose Hill, NC, 5 grandchildren, 7 great grandchildren and numerous nieces and nephews.
She now rests with Jesus, beyond the veil of tears, free from all the pain and suffering she endured for so long. She awaits only her beloved husband to walk together through the gates of Heaven someday soon.
A memorial service celebrating her life will be held Saturday, December 16, 2017 from 2-4 PM at Centuries Memorial funeral Home on Mansfield Rd. in Shreveport, LA.
